Transaction 8f52054d5e1edecc8abe61003e63456f8bc641c4bbd073e73ecc0df49ec96240

1 Input
2 Outputs
  • 8f52054d5e1edecc8abe61003e63456f8bc641c4bbd073e73ecc0df49ec96240:0
  • value  7120156
    address  33uHMQzex21VaC4Cbk9Nswm73CsSQk38VF
  • 8f52054d5e1edecc8abe61003e63456f8bc641c4bbd073e73ecc0df49ec96240:1
  • value  2857844
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c